A video capturing a heated argument between BJP lawmakers Rajesh Chaudhary and Saurabh Srivastava during the Uttar Pradesh assembly's monsoon session has gone viral. The clash erupted when Chaudhary, representing Mathura, was denied his allocated speaking time due to extended speeches by others. Srivastava, acting as chief whip, engaged in a verbal exchange with Chaudhary, prompting intervention from other members.

A devastating cloudburst in Kishtwar's Chesoti village along the Machail Mata Yatra route has claimed at least 60 lives, injured over 100, and left many missing. Survivors recounted a sudden flash flood engulfing the area after a blast-like sound. Rescue operations are underway, with the army, police, SDRF, and civilian agencies working together.

India and China have agreed to enhance border dispute resolution efforts following talks between NSA Ajit Doval and Chinese Foreign Minister Wang Yi. An Expert Group will be established under the WMCC to expedite boundary delimitation. Both sides committed to a fair and mutually acceptable settlement, improved border management, and new mechanisms for de-escalation.
Google and Kairos Power are partnering to build an advanced nuclear plant in Tennessee, aiming to connect to the TVA grid by 2030. TVA will purchase up to 50 megawatts from Kairos' Hermes 2 reactor, enough to power 36,000 homes and support Google's data centers.

During India's National Emergency (1975-1977), over 10.7 million people were sterilised, exceeding government targets by 60%. The Justice Shah Commission, investigating Emergency excesses, revealed widespread complaints, including forced sterilisations and related deaths. States like Maharashtra, Madhya Pradesh, and Uttar Pradesh conducted the most sterilisations, driven by a focus on this single method and incentives/disincentives.
Hamas gunmen launched a daring raid on an IDF encampment in southern Gaza, resulting in injuries to four Israeli soldiers. The attack involved at least 18 militants emerging from a tunnel, opening fire with machine guns and RPGs. Israeli forces responded with small arms and air support, eliminating approximately ten militants.
